- The distance between Matsumoto, Japan and Carlinville, Il, Usa is approximately 10,292 km or 6,395 mi.
- To reach Matsumoto in this distance one would set out from Carlinville, Il bearing 323.2°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Matsumoto bearing 215.1° or SW .
- Both have a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Matsumoto is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Carlinville, Il is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 0.9 °C (1.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.6 °C (4.7°F) less in Matsumoto.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 24.4 mm (1 in) more which is equivalent to 24.4 l/m² (0.6 US gal/ft²) or 244,000 l/ha (26,085 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3° higher in Matsumoto than in Carlinville, Il.
